“Let’s get a divorce, Renee.”

The man’s cold voice sounded from behind while Renee Everheart was in the middle of searing steaks. After hearing those words, she became seemingly numb to the hot oil splattering on her cheeks from the lightly sizzling pan.

“We’re only husband and wife on paper. Now that four years have passed, it’s time to end this,” Stefan Hunt said with a cold, distant tone.

Renee bit her lip anxiously.

‘Looks like this day was inevitable after all…’

Her family was declared bankrupt four years ago. Her parents, unable to endure the stress of financial hardship, took their lives together, leaving young Renee to handle the mess alone.

In the past, Renee’s grandfather fought alongside Stefan’s grandfather on the battlefield, and he even saved the latter’s life once. In his dying moments, he voiced out to his old pal his concern for his granddaughter and left Renee under his care.

And so, a marriage of convenience was arranged between Stefan and Renee to put the old man’s concerns to rest.

As time passed, Renee found herself falling in love with the man she married. She thought that as long as she played the role of a good wife, he would reciprocate her feelings one day.

However, what transpired was the complete opposite of what she had hoped for.

“I’ll give you 40 million dollars and a penthouse at Long Beach. Here are the divorce papers. Sign them if you have no objections.”

Stefan then pushed a document towards Renee. His stern expression indicated that this was no more than another business transaction to him.

Renee skimmed through the string of numbers.

‘40 million dollars for four years, huh? The Hunts are still as wealthy as ever,’ she thought to herself.

“Do we have to?” She put down the document and stared at her husband.

The man she had loved for four years was drop-dead gorgeous, yet his beautiful face was always stern and distant.

“Yes,” Stefan replied without a hint of hesitation.

Renee’s heart stung, but she was not one to drag things out. As her objections had fallen on deaf ears, she knew it was time for her to go.

‘Whatever, I got 40 million for the years I’ve spent being his wife. This is more than worth it!’

“Alright.” She picked up a pen and scribbled her signature on the papers decisively.

Stefan was taken aback by her resoluteness. The Renee he knew was fragile and indecisive, and he had never seen this side of her.

For some reason, this left a sour taste in his mouth.

“I’ll let you know once this is processed. If it’s possible, I’d like you to move out by tonight.” The man said, brushing off the unpleasant feeling in his chest before leaving.

It was painfully obvious that he didn’t intend on discussing the matter over.

On the very same night, the housekeeper immediately threw Renee’s belongings out of the villa after receiving news of the divorce. It wasn’t like she respected Renee back then, but now that they were officially separating, she became openly hostile.

“Serves you right, you gold-digging leech! It’s about time they decided to kick you out!”

Renee had no choice but to crouch down and pick her scattered clothing up. The cold night breeze only served to rub salt in her wound.

Just then, she heard the sound of a car rolling to a stop behind her. A tall slender woman emerged from the vehicle.

“Ms. Desrosiers, you’re here! Welcome, welcome!” The housekeeper, who was just yelling profanities at Renee, immediately jumped to the guest’s assistance.

However, Briar Desrosiers didn’t even bother to spare the housekeeper a glance. “Be careful with my belongings. If you break even a single thing, you wouldn’t be able to pay it back within a lifetime.”

Renee’s entire body stiffened up. In mere seconds, the pieces fell into place in her mind.
